Synopsis:


In "Abraham Lincoln: a History — Volume 01," authors John Hay and John G. Nicolay present a captivating and comprehensive account of the life and political career of one of America's most iconic figures. This first volume delves into Lincoln's early years, from his humble beginnings in Kentucky to his rise as a prominent lawyer and politician in Illinois. Through meticulous research and engaging storytelling, the authors shed light on Lincoln's personal struggles, his unwavering commitment to justice, and his unwavering belief in the preservation of the Union. As the nation teeters on the brink of division and civil war, Lincoln's journey unfolds, revealing the qualities that would make him a legendary leader.
